What is it like to work in Shreveport, LA?

Working in Shreveport, LA, offers a mix of opportunities in different industries. Companies such as CenturyLink, Ouachita Chemical, and Barksdale Air Force Base provide jobs for many people. The city also has attractions like the Shreveport WaterWorks Museum and the Riverfest event, making it a fun place to live and work.


Shreveport has a growing economy with job openings in healthcare, technology, and manufacturing. The city's location along the Red River makes it easy for people to enjoy outdoor activities and events. Local colleges and universities also offer training programs and certifications to help people advance in their careers.

Do you need a car in Shreveport, LA?

Having a car in Shreveport, LA, can make job hunting easier and more efficient. Public transportation options are available, but they may not cover all the areas where job opportunities exist. A car allows for greater flexibility and convenience when commuting to interviews.


Additionally, Shreveport's traffic and road conditions can vary, so a reliable car can help ensure timely arrivals. Employers often value candidates who can demonstrate their reliability, and having a car can help with this. Access to a car also opens up more job opportunities, especially in areas not well-served by public transit.

Living in Shreveport, Louisiana, means embracing a vibrant community with diverse transportation options. A car is highly recommended for those who want flexibility and convenience. This is especially true for commuting to work, running errands, and attending social events. The city's sprawling layout and occasional traffic can make driving a practical choice.

Several public transportation options do exist in Shreveport. The Caddo Commuter provides bus services across the city. This can be a cost-effective option for those who do not mind a less flexible schedule. Additionally, ridesharing services like Uber and Lyft are widely available. They offer another convenient way to get around without the commitment of owning a car. However, these options may not cover all areas or run at all hours, making a personal vehicle a reliable backup.
